+918306020200
info@anyleson.com
English flag
English
Select a Language
English flag
English
Arabic flag
Arabic
Spanish flag
Spanish
0
Ultimate Data Structures & Algorithms: Part 2

Ultimate Data Structures & Algorithms: Part 2

Say goodbye to scattered tutorials and endless fluff. This course gives you a clear, structured path with bite-sized videos that blend theory and hands-on practice.
0 Students
101 Lectures
Code With Mosh
Code With Mosh

Instructor

About This Course

Highly Practical

What You'll Learn

  • Binary Trees: Understand binary tree structure, traversal algorithms, and applications
  • AVL Trees: Explore balanced binary search trees like AVL trees for efficient searching and insertion
  • Heaps: Study min heaps and max heaps, including heapify operations and heap sort algorithm
  • Tries: Delve into trie data structures for efficient word/key searching and storage
  • Graphs: Learn about directed and undirected graphs, BFS, DFS, and other graph algorithm
Code With Mosh
Code With Mosh
18 Courses
0 Students
Code With Mosh
Curriculum Overview

This course includes 7 modules, 101 lessons, and 0 hours of materials.

Getting Started
1 Parts
Introduction
Volume 50.2 MB
Binary Trees
19 Parts
Introduction
Free
Volume 47.1 MB
What are Trees
Volume 65.0 MB
Exercise- Populating a Binary Search Tree
Volume 1.3 MB
Exercise- Building a Tree
Volume 36.0 MB
Solution- insert()
Volume 172.7 MB
Solution- find()
Volume 36.5 MB
Traversing Trees
Volume 49.0 MB
Exercise- Tree Traversal
Volume 95.3 MB
Recursion
Volume 97.2 MB
Depth First Traversals
Volume 109.1 MB
Depth and Height of Nodes
Volume 107.2 MB
Minimum Value in a Tree
Volume 175.0 MB
Exercise- Equality Checking
Volume 18.0 MB
Solution- Equality Checking
Volume 98.9 MB
Exercise- Validating Binary Search Trees
Volume 37.2 MB
Solution- Validating Binary Search Trees
Volume 119.6 MB
Exercise- Nodes at K Distance
Volume 14.4 MB
Solution- Nodes at K Distance from the Root
Volume 141.2 MB
Level Order Traversal
Volume 47.8 MB
AVL Trees
17 Parts
Introduction
Free
Volume 2.8 MB
Balanced and Unbalanced Trees
Volume 43.0 MB
Rotations
Volume 43.7 MB
AVL Trees
Volume 28.3 MB
AVL Rotations
Volume 4.2 MB
Exercise- Building an AVL Tree
Volume 17.3 MB
Solution- insert()
Volume 233.4 MB
Exercise- Height Calculation
Volume 33.7 MB
Solution- Height Calculation
Volume 68.9 MB
Exercise- Balance Factor
Volume 45.2 MB
Solution- Balance Factor
Volume 134.8 MB
Exercise- Detecting Rotations
Volume 31.0 MB
Solution- Detecting Rotations
Volume 127.6 MB
Exercise- Implementing Rotations
Volume 81.0 MB
Solution- Implementing Rotations
Volume 219.4 MB
AVL Trees- Exercises
Volume 34.0 MB
Summary
Volume 7.6 MB
Heaps
16 Parts
Introduction
Free
Volume 1.9 MB
What are Heaps
Volume 44.2 MB
Exercise- Working with Heaps
Volume 4.0 MB
Exercise- Building a Heap
Volume 16.1 MB
Solution- insert()
Volume 193.1 MB
Solution- remove()
Volume 238.6 MB
Solution - Edge Cases
Volume 229.0 MB
Heap Sort
Volume 54.0 MB
Priority Queues
Volume 113.7 MB
Exercise- Heapify
Volume 18.1 MB
Solution- Heapify
Volume 185.0 MB
Solution- Optimization
Volume 56.8 MB
Exercise- Kth Largest Item
Volume 6.9 MB
Solution- Kth Largest Item
Volume 96.9 MB
Heaps- Exercises
Volume 43.5 MB
Summary
Volume 10.7 MB
Tries
16 Parts
Introduction
Free
Volume 2.2 MB
What are Tries
Volume 63.2 MB
Exercise- Populating a Trie
Volume 20.0 MB
Exercise- Building a Trie
Volume 21.4 MB
Solution- Building a Trie
Volume 127.9 MB
An Implementation with a HashTable
Volume 53.0 MB
A Better Abstraction
Volume 206.3 MB
Exercise- Looking Up a Word
Volume 20.8 MB
Solution- Looking Up a Word
Volume 61.2 MB
Traversals
Volume 81.8 MB
Exercise- Removing a Word
Volume 12.4 MB
Solution- Removing a Word
Volume 226.9 MB
Exercise- Auto Completion
Volume 16.6 MB
Solution- Auto Completion
Volume 175.2 MB
Tries- Exercises
Volume 43.0 MB
Summary
Volume 7.3 MB
Graphs
19 Parts
Introduction
Volume 2.2 MB
What are Graphs
Volume 15.9 MB
Adjacency Matrix
Volume 25.7 MB
Adjacency List
Volume 60.0 MB
Exercise- Building a Graph
Volume 15.3 MB
Solution- Adding Nodes and Edges
Volume 203.8 MB
Solution- Removing Nodes and Edges
Volume 110.2 MB
Traversal Algorithms
Volume 30.6 MB
Exercise- Traversal Algorithms
Volume 215 MB
Exercise- Depth-first Traversal (Recursive)
Volume 8.5 MB
Solution- Depth-first Traversal (Recursive)
Volume 99.2 MB
Exercise- Depth-first Traversal (Iterative)
Volume 50.4 MB
Solution- Depth-first Traversal (Iterative)
Volume 116.5 MB
Exercise- Breadth-first Traversal (Iterative)
Volume 10.4 MB
Solution- Breadth-first Traversal
Volume 63.6 MB
Exercise- Topological Sorting
Volume 51.4 MB
Solution- Topological Sort
Volume 111.0 MB
Exercise- Cycle Detection (Directed Graphs)
Volume 30.8 MB
Solution- Cycle Detection (Directed Graphs)
Volume 174.4 MB
Undirected Graphs
13 Parts
Introduction
Volume 2.7 MB
Exercise- Weighted Graphs
Volume 10.5 MB
Solution- Weighted Graphs
Volume 170.8 MB
An Object-oriented Solution
Volume 243.5 MB
Dijkstra_s Shortest Path Algorithm
Volume 42.2 MB
Exercise- Getting the Shortest Distance
Volume 146.7 MB
Solution- The Shortest Distance
Volume 160.3 MB
Solution- Shortest Path
Volume 267.2 MB
Exercise- Cycle Detection (Undirected Graphs)
Volume 15.8 MB
Solution- Cycle Detection (Undirected Graphs)
Volume 111.1 MB
Minimum Spanning Tree
Volume 11.2 MB
Exercise- Prim_s Algorithm
Volume 19.9 MB
Solution- Prim_s Algorithm
Volume 412.3 MB
Reply to Comment
Comments Approval

Your comment will be visible after admin approval.

0
0 Reviews
Content Quality (0)
Instructor Skills (0)
Value for Money (0)
Support Quality (0)
Reply to Review
Submit Reply

Your reply to this review will be visible to all users.

Ultimate Data Structures & Algorithms: Part 2
$1,000
Subscribe

This Course Includes

Downloadable Content
Instructor Support
Course Forum

Course Specifications

Sections
7
Lessons
101
Capacity
Unlimited
Duration
6:00 Hours
Students
0
Access Duration
99999 Days
Created Date
17 Nov 2025
Updated Date
17 Nov 2025
Ultimate Data Structures & Algorithms: Part 2
You are viewing
Ultimate Data Structures & Algorithms: Part 2